Directed by Curtis Hanson , the film is a masterclass in tension, ditching flashy CGI for real-world stakes on the dangerous rapids of the Salmon River. Plot Overview The River Wild(1994)
The story follows (Meryl Streep), a former river guide who takes her family on a white-water rafting trip in Idaho to celebrate her son's birthday and attempt to repair her strained marriage with her workaholic husband, Tom (David Strathairn). Their vacation turns into a nightmare when they cross paths with two men, Wade (Kevin Bacon) and Terry (John C. Reilly), who appear to be inexperienced rafters but are actually armed fugitives fleeing a robbery. The criminals take the family hostage, forcing Gail to navigate them through a nearly impossible stretch of river known as "The Gauntlet" to evade the authorities.
